The Rochester Pean Forceps: A Heavy-Duty Gripper
First up, let's talk about the Rochester Pean forceps. When you hear "Rochester Pean," think robust and deep tissue. These forceps are generally longer and heavier than many other types of clamps. They are designed for use in deeper surgical sites, where a longer reach is necessary. The jaws of the Rochester Pean are typically serrated along their entire length, meaning they have a series of parallel grooves. This full serration provides a very secure grip, which is essential when you need to hold onto tougher, thicker tissues or when you're dealing with significant bleeding and need to occlude larger vessels. Because of their strength and length, they are often employed in abdominal surgeries, orthopedic procedures, and other situations requiring substantial hemostasis (controlling bleeding) or retraction of deep tissues. The Rochester Pean forceps' design is all about providing a strong, unwavering hold in challenging surgical environments. Their substantial construction allows them to withstand considerable pressure without bending or failing, which is obviously a non-negotiable requirement in any surgical instrument. You'll find them indispensable when you need to clamp off major blood vessels or grasp robust connective tissues that smaller, more delicate forceps simply couldn't manage. The Kelly Forceps: The Versatile All-Rounder
Now, let's pivot to the Kelly forceps. These are perhaps one of the most commonly recognized and widely used hemostatic forceps. Think of Kelly forceps as the versatile workhorses of the surgical world. They are typically shorter and more streamlined than the Rochester Pean forceps. The key distinguishing feature of Kelly forceps lies in the serrations on their jaws. While they do have serrations, they are usually transverse (running across the jaw) and are often present only on the distal half or two-thirds of the jaw. This means the tip might be smooth or have a different serration pattern. This type of serration provides a good grip but is generally less aggressive than the full-length serrations of the Rochester Pean. This makes Kelly forceps ideal for a broader range of tasks, including grasping softer tissues, controlling smaller to medium-sized blood vessels, and general retraction. They are frequently used in procedures such as gynecological surgeries, general abdominal procedures, and thoracic surgeries. The Kelly forceps' adaptability is their superpower. They offer a balance between secure grasping and gentler tissue handling, making them suitable for a multitude of surgical scenarios. Their design allows for precise manipulation, which is crucial when working with delicate structures or when minimizing tissue trauma is a priority. The transverse serrations, combined with the overall design, enable surgeons to achieve effective hemostasis without crushing tissues unnecessarily. Key Differences Summarized: It's All in the Jaws and Length!
So, let's break down the core differences between these two trusty surgical tools. The most apparent distinction lies in their jaw serrations and overall length. Rochester Pean forceps boast full-length, longitudinal serrations, providing an extremely strong and secure grip, ideal for deep, tough tissues and large vessels. Their longer length is specifically engineered for reaching deeper into the body cavity. Kelly forceps, on the other hand, typically feature shorter, transverse serrations that are usually confined to the distal part of the jaw. This design offers a firm but less aggressive grip, making them more versatile for grasping a wider range of tissues and smaller to medium vessels, and they are generally shorter, allowing for better maneuverability in less deep or more confined surgical fields. Think of it this way: if you need to hold onto something with a vice-like grip in a deep, challenging spot, you'll probably reach for the Rochester Pean. If you need a reliable, all-purpose clamp for more general tasks, controlling moderate bleeding, or working with less dense tissues, the Kelly forceps are your go-to. Beyond the Basics: Other Forceps and Considerations
While we've focused on the Rochester Pean vs. Kelly forceps, it's important to remember that the world of surgical forceps is vast and varied, guys! There are many other types of forceps, each with its unique design and purpose. For instance, Crile forceps are very similar to Kelly forceps but typically have serrations that extend the full length of the jaws, similar to the Rochester Pean but generally shorter and finer. Mosquito hemostatic forceps are tiny, delicate clamps used for grasping very small blood vessels or for fine tissue manipulation where minimal trauma is desired. Then you have Allis forceps, which have sharp, interdigitating teeth designed to grasp and hold tissue very securely, often used for fascia or skin, but they can cause significant tissue damage if used improperly. When choosing between instruments like the Rochester Pean and Kelly, surgeons also consider the material, the finish (e.g., polished vs. satin), and ergonomics. The weight and balance of the instrument can affect a surgeon's fatigue during long procedures. Furthermore, the sterilization process is a critical factor for all surgical instruments. Both Rochester Pean and Kelly forceps, like all reusable surgical tools, must be meticulously cleaned and sterilized according to strict protocols to prevent surgical site infections.
